Glass

Double-glazed windows are composed of two panes with an airspace between them. The air is filled with gases like argon and krypton that slow down the heat transfer through your windows. This helps keep your home at a pleasant temperature without straining your cooling and heating system. If one of your double glazed windows is damaged or cracked, you'll want to repair it quickly.

Usually, Double Glazed Window Repairs replacing the glass in your double glazed upvc window repair near me will be the best method to repair it. It's important to know that fixing double-paned windows entails more than simply replacing the glass. It also involves making repairs to the factory seal in order to make your window function just as it should. The first step to fix double-glazed windows is to take off the old pane. This must be done with care to prevent further damage to the glass. The next step is to remove any sealants or paints from the edges of the glass. You can use a putty blade or scraper to get rid of the sealant. After the old pane is removed, the new pane can be put in the frame. A new layer of sealant needs to be applied.
